Remote Field Monitoring and Data Acquisition System Using GSM

Remote monitoring is the technique which is used to transmit useful information between the locations which are far away from each other and cannot exchange information through direct contact. As temperature and humidity are very important factors for determining any environment, it is very important that temperature and humidity of environment be monitored. For the high quality environment the quality testing is required. So the main aim of this paper is to get informed about the environmental changes wirelessly. This paper proposes a remote monitoring system based on GSM measuring temperature and humidity. Temperature sensor, humidity sensor and GSM communication technology are used in the system which performs data acquisition and transmission, and implements remote monitoring. In this paper the temperature and humidity of two places are monitored and sent to the receiving end using multiplexing.
